Bilal, the negro, was certainly one of these slaves. He was the slave of Omayya bin Khalaf. Omayya was a heartless guy. He would strip Bilal of all dresses, make him lie about the burning sand at mid-working day then lash him mercilessly. Despite this torture Bilal would go on declaring, "Allah is one! Allah is one particular!" Someday Abu Bakf occurred to go by. He was considerably moved from the sight. "Why are you currently so cruel to this helpless person?" he questioned Omayya. "If you really feel for him, why Really don't you purchase him?" retored Omayya. So Abu Bakr at once bought Bilal in a heavy price tag and established him absolutely free. Bilal Later on turned the properly-recognised "Muazzin" [ one particular who offers the demand prayer ] for the Prophet's Mosque.

Adhering to Muhammad's death in 632, Abu Bakr succeeded the leadership with the Muslim community as the primary caliph, being elected at Saqifa. His election was contested by several rebellious tribal leaders. During his reign, he overcame several uprisings, collectively often known as the Ridda Wars, as a result of which he was capable to consolidate and develop the rule of the Muslim state in excess of your complete Arabian Peninsula. He also commanded the initial incursions in to the neighboring Sasanian and Byzantine empires, which while in the decades following his death, would at some point cause the Muslim conquests of Persia plus the Levant.

In 622, to the invitation in the Muslims of Yathrib (later Medina), Muhammad purchased his followers emigrate there. The migration commenced in batches. Ali was the last to remain in Mecca, entrusted with obligation for settling any financial loans the Muslims experienced taken out, and famously slept from the bed of Muhammad if the Quraysh, led by Ikrima, tried to murder Muhammad Abubakar Muhammad as he slept. Meanwhile, Abu Bakr accompanied Muhammad to Medina. Due to danger posed because of the Quraysh, they didn't take the street, but moved in the alternative direction, using refuge in a cave in Jabal Thawr, some five miles south of Mecca.
